Parrots belong to the family Psittacidae, which consists of approximately 393 species, contributing to their diverse variety. These birds are characterized by their strong, curved beaks, an upright position, strong legs, and an ability to simulate sounds, Graupapageienarten including human speech. Parrots are found in tropical and subtropical regions worldwide, making them a typical sight in locations with lush plants.

Parrot Habitat and Distribution
Parrots can be found in a range of environments, consisting of:

Rainforests: Most species grow in the thick canopies of tropical rain forests, where they find plentiful food sources.

Woodlands: Some types occupy semi-arid areas with spread trees.

Savannas: Parrots can often be seen foraging outdoors meadows where they look for seeds and fruits.

Parrots are understood for their complex social structures and behaviors. In the wild, Spielzeug Für Graupapageien they usually form flocks varying from a couple of to a number of hundred birds. These social groups assist supply safety from predators as well as companionship.
Secret Behavioral Traits:
Mimicking Ability: Parrots are renowned for their capability to mimic human speech and other noises they hear in their environment.

Playfulness: Parrots are extremely smart and curious animals, often participating in playful activities that stimulate their minds.

Bonding: In social settings, they demonstrate strong bonds with their mates and flock members, regularly taking part in mutual grooming and vocalizations.

Parrot Conservation Challenges
Many parrot types are facing substantial threats in the wild due to environment loss, climate modification, and the prohibited pet trade. Preservation efforts are vital to guarantee the survival of these gorgeous birds. Organizations worldwide work to secure their environments, Graupapageienzüchter impose laws versus wildlife trafficking, Graupapagei Zucht and promote awareness about their predicament.
